A ring modulator outputs the product (Multiplication X • Y) of the signals at inputs X and Y. It's similar to a VCA, but whereas a VCA only responds to positive voltages at the inputs (2-quadrant multiplication), the ring modulator responds to both positive and negative voltages (4-quadrant multiplication).\u003cbr\u003e The ring modulator thus provides a refinement of amplitude modulation (AM). Ordinary amplitude modulation will output the original carrier frequency fC as well as the two side bands (fC - fM, fC + fM) for each of the spectral components of the carrier and modulation signals - but ring modulation cancels out the carrier frequencies, and just lets the side-bands pass to the output (see Fig. 1).\u003cbr\u003e A ring modulator is used for the production of bell-like sounds, alien voices, or just to produce new timbres.\u003c\/span\u003e\u003c\/p\u003e\n\u003cp\u003e\u003cspan\u003e\u003cspan\u003eBreite\/Width: 4TE \/ 4HP \/ 20.0 mm\u003cbr\u003e Tiefe\/Depth: 40 mm (gemessen ab der Rückseite der Frontplatte \/ measured from the rear side of the front panel)\u003cbr\u003e Strombedarf\/Current: 40mA\u003c\/span\u003e\u003c\/span\u003e\u003c\/p\u003e","brand":"Doepfer","offers":[{"title":"Default Title","offer_id":42307295871165,"sku":"1016012","price":132.99,"currency_code":"CAD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0526\/4175\/9421\/products\/doepfera114dualringmodulator.png?v=1625885540"},{"product_id":"doepfer-a-133-dual-voltage-controlled-polarizer","title":"Doepfer A-133 Dual Voltage Controlled Polarizer","description":"\u003cp\u003e-133 is a special dual voltage controlled amplifier that enables both positive and negative amplifications. What CENTER means is adjustable via knob and CV control. XSOME is particularly interesting, as it has the same general shape as a multiplication function, but with sharper edges. What this means it that Babel will create ring-mod like intermodulation—but with extra harmonics like those produced with a wavefolder, and with an arbitary number of inputs, instead of just two.\u003c\/p\u003e\n\u003cp\u003eWhen viewed as a logic module, Babel takes any group of truth values and tells you whether any of them are true (ANY, the equivalent of “or” with just two values), whether all of them are true (ALL, the equivalent of “and” with just two values), and whether some, but not all of them are true (XSOME, the equivalent of “xor” with just two values). Turn CENTER all the way to the right for 0–+5V logic, or leave it centered for −5V–+5V logic—handy when your “logic” modules are really LFOs.\u003c\/p\u003e\n\u003cp\u003e \u003c\/p\u003e","brand":"New Systems Intruments","offers":[{"title":"Default Title","offer_id":42768573890749,"sku":"1032633","price":169.0,"currency_code":"CAD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0526\/4175\/9421\/files\/new-system-instrument-babel.jpg?v=1710442474"},{"product_id":"new-systems-instruments-babel-expander","title":"New Systems Instruments Babel Expander","description":"The Babel expander gives you 7 more inputs for Babel. A ring modulator outputs the product (Multiplication X • Y) of the signals at inputs X and Y. It's similar to a VCA, but whereas a VCA only responds to positive voltages at the inputs (2-quadrant multiplication), the ring modulator responds to both positive and negative voltages (4-quadrant multiplication).\u003c\/span\u003e\u003c\/p\u003e\n\u003cp class=\"p1\"\u003e\u003cspan class=\"s1\"\u003eThe ring modulator thus provides a refinement of amplitude modulation (AM). Ordinary amplitude modulation will output the original carrier frequency fC as well as the two side bands (fC - fM, fC + fM) for each of the spectral components of the carrier and modulation signals - but ring modulation cancels out the carrier frequencies, and just lets the side-bands pass to the output (see Fig. 1).\u003c\/span\u003e\u003c\/p\u003e\n\u003cp class=\"p1\"\u003e\u003cspan class=\"s1\"\u003eA ring modulator is used for the production of bell-like sounds, alien voices, or just to produce new timbres.\u003c\/span\u003e\u003c\/p\u003e","brand":"Doepfer","offers":[{"title":"Default Title","offer_id":42997129248957,"sku":"1016143","price":148.99,"currency_code":"CAD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0526\/4175\/9421\/files\/DoepferA-114VVintageEditionBlack.jpg?v=1741961916"},{"product_id":"doepfer-a-184-1-ringmod-s-h-slew","title":"Doepfer A-184-1 ringmod\/s\u0026h\/slew","description":"\u003cp class=\"p1\"\u003e\u003cspan class=\"s1\"\u003eModule A-184-1 is the combination of three functions: \u003c\/span\u003e\u003c\/p\u003e\n\u003cul\u003e\n\u003cli class=\"li2\"\u003e\n\u003cspan class=\"s2\"\u003e\u003c\/span\u003e\u003cspan class=\"s3\"\u003eRing Modulator\u003c\/span\u003e\n\u003c\/li\u003e\n\u003cli class=\"li2\"\u003e\n\u003cspan class=\"s2\"\u003e\u003c\/span\u003e\u003cspan class=\"s3\"\u003eSample\u0026amp;Hold\/Track\u0026amp;Hold unit\u003c\/span\u003e\n\u003c\/li\u003e\n\u003cli class=\"li2\"\u003e\n\u003cspan class=\"s2\"\u003e\u003c\/span\u003e\u003cspan class=\"s3\"\u003eSlew Limiter\u003c\/span\u003e\n\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003cp class=\"p1\"\u003e\u003cspan class=\"s1\"\u003eThe same functions are actually already available in other modules (e.g. A-114, A-148, A-170). That's why we have compiled these function in one small 4 HP module.\u003c\/span\u003e\u003c\/p\u003e\n\u003cp class=\"p1\"\u003e\u003cspan class=\"s1\"\u003eThe upper section is nothing but half of an A-114, i.e. a ring modulator with the usual X\/Y inputs and the X*Y output. Inputs and outputs of this sub-unit are AC coupled, i.e. suitable only for audio signals. A detailed explanation of a ring modulator can be found on the A-114 info page. \u003c\/span\u003e\u003c\/p\u003e\n\u003cp class=\"p1\"\u003e\u003cspan class=\"s1\"\u003eThe lower section is the combination of a Sample \u0026amp; Hold (S\u0026amp;H) \/ Track \u0026amp; Hold (T\u0026amp;H) unit and a Slew Limiter. The S\u0026amp;H\/T\u0026amp;H unit is identical to one half of the module A-148. The slew limiter is the same as the upper section the A-170. The S\u0026amp;H\/T\u0026amp;H unit and the slew limiter are internally connected and cannot be used separately. The max. slew time is about 10 seconds.\u003c\/span\u003e\u003c\/p\u003e\n\u003cp class=\"p1\"\u003e\u003cspan class=\"s1\"\u003eA toggle switch is used to set the mode to S\u0026amp;H or T\u0026amp;H. In S\u0026amp;H mode the unit picks out a sample from the voltage at the SH input at the rising edge of the trigger signal input. In T\u0026amp;H mode the output follows the input voltage as long as the level of the trigger signal is high. As soon as the trigger signal turns low, the last voltage is stored. The trigger input is internally normalled to high, i.e. the unit works just as a slew limiter in T\u0026amp;H mode when no trigger signal is applied.\u003c\/span\u003e\u003c\/p\u003e\n\u003cp class=\"p1\"\u003e\u003cspan class=\"s1\"\u003eDetailed explanations of S\u0026amp;H\/T\u0026amp;H and slew limiters can be found on the info pages of the modules A-148 and A-170.\u003c\/span\u003e\u003c\/p\u003e","brand":"Doepfer","offers":[{"title":"Default Title","offer_id":42997143666877,"sku":"1016157","price":171.99,"currency_code":"CAD","in_stock":false}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0526\/4175\/9421\/files\/DoepferA-184-1ringmods_hslew.jpg?v=1741918148"},{"product_id":"erica-synths-hexinverter-mindphaser-dual-oscillator","title":"Erica Synths Hexinverter Mindphaser Dual Oscillator","description":"\u003cp class=\"p1\" data-mce-fragment=\"1\"\u003eMindphaser is a next generation complex dual oscillator for the Eurorack modular synthesizer format.
